Output 1ba885a932b9167b469b4103062a21e2520500edfdbd9b20c67cd97299942f6d:0

value
5914923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0396eaac3e2f7dcf4d55f0811348f686a389420f OP_EQUAL
address
321zjzeaXK28YFWPtbHg6rEr6x51sZ8Bpo
transaction
1ba885a932b9167b469b4103062a21e2520500edfdbd9b20c67cd97299942f6d
spent
true